31 Indians will be part of World Para Athletics Championships that begins today

THE OPENING CEREMONY of the 8th World Para Athletics Championships will take place at the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park in London today. These Championships are scheduled from July 14-23, 2017.

The best Para Athletes of the World will take part in these Championships including 31 Indian Para Athletes which will try their best to bring the Gold for their country.

Today’s schedule will include events of strong medal contenders like Sundar Singh Gurjar and Virender along with 4 other Para Athletes.

Last year, in the Rio Paralympics, India's contingent had 19 delegates. It was India's best performance clinching four medals which included two gold, a silver and a bronze.

Mariyappan Thangavelu, Devendra Jhajhariya, Deepa Malik and Varun Singh Bhati were the winners of medals at Rio.
